25 Budget-Friendly Engagement Party Decoration Ideas That Look Expensive

Planning an engagement party is one of the most exciting parts of celebrating your journey together. The good news is that creating a beautiful venue doesn't require a huge budget. With a little creativity and thoughtful planning, you can transform almost any space into a stylish celebration your guests will remember.

Whether you're hosting your engagement party at home, in a backyard, or at a rented venue, these budget-friendly engagement party decoration ideas will help you achieve an elegant look while keeping costs under control.


1. Choose a Simple Color Palette

Instead of buying decorations in every color, stick to two or three complementary shades. Popular combinations include white and gold, blush pink and ivory, sage green and cream, navy and silver, and champagne and beige.

A consistent color palette instantly makes your decorations appear professionally designed.


2. Create a Balloon Backdrop

Balloon garlands have become one of the most popular engagement party decorations. Mix different balloon sizes and include metallic balloons for a luxury appearance. Add greenery or artificial flowers to make the display look even more elegant.

A balloon backdrop is perfect for a welcome entrance, dessert table, couple photos, and selfie station.


3. Decorate with Candles

Candles provide warmth and romance without costing much. Use pillar candles, floating candles, tea lights, or LED candles for safety. Grouping candles of different heights creates an upscale centerpiece.


4. Use Fresh Greenery Instead of Large Floral Arrangements

Fresh flowers can quickly consume your decorating budget. Instead, decorate tables using eucalyptus, olive branches, ferns, or ivy. Add a few fresh flowers throughout the greenery to create an elegant look at a fraction of the price.


5. Personalize a Welcome Sign

Welcome signs instantly make guests feel special. Include the couple's names, engagement date, and a short greeting. You can print the design yourself and place it in an inexpensive frame.


6. String Lights Transform Any Space

Warm white fairy lights create a magical atmosphere. Wrap them around trees, railings, ceilings, backdrops, and photo booths. They're especially effective for evening celebrations.


7. Use Fabric Instead of Expensive Decorations

Soft draped fabric can completely transform a room. Affordable options include sheer curtains, tulle, chiffon, and gauze table runners. These materials add elegance while covering plain walls or tables.


8. Create DIY Table Centerpieces

Simple centerpieces often look better than elaborate ones. Ideas include candles in glass jars, small flower vases, mason jars, wooden slices, and decorative lanterns.


9. Add Gold Accents

Small metallic touches create a luxury feel. Consider gold charger plates, gold candle holders, gold cutlery, metallic balloons, and gold ribbon. A little goes a long way.


10. Build a Photo Corner

Guests love taking pictures. Create a dedicated photo area using a balloon arch, neon sign, floral wall, decorative chair, or personalized backdrop. The photos become lasting memories of your celebration.


11. Use Printed Photos of Your Relationship

Print favorite photos together and display them using twine and clothespins, picture frames, wooden easels, or memory boards. This inexpensive decoration adds a meaningful personal touch.


12. Decorate the Dessert Table

Your dessert table naturally becomes a focal point. Enhance it with cake stands, matching cupcake toppers, fresh greenery, candles, and balloon arrangements.


13. Rent Instead of Buying

Many decorative items can be rented, including arches, neon signs, backdrops, easels, and centerpieces. Renting often costs far less than purchasing.


14. Mix Real and Artificial Flowers

Artificial flowers have improved dramatically in quality. Combine them with small amounts of fresh flowers to create lush arrangements while reducing costs.


15. Use Matching Table Linens

Uniform tablecloths instantly improve the overall appearance of your venue. Neutral colors like ivory, white, beige, or champagne work with nearly every theme.


16. Add Personalized Table Numbers

Even if you only have a few tables, customized table numbers help tie your design together. Use acrylic, wood, or printable templates.


17. Create a Signature Drink Station

Decorate a beverage station with matching labels, decorative trays, lemon slices, fresh herbs, and elegant dispensers. It serves as both decoration and functionality.


18. Display Engagement Quotes

Frame romantic quotes throughout the venue. Examples include "Forever Starts Here," "She Said Yes," "Our Next Chapter," and "Together Is a Beautiful Place to Be."


19. Use Decorative Mirrors

Mirrors reflect light and make small spaces appear larger. Use them beneath centerpieces or as welcome displays.


20. Decorate Chairs with Ribbon

Instead of renting expensive chair covers, tie elegant ribbons or greenery around selected chairs. This simple upgrade makes a noticeable difference.


21. Create a Memory Table

Display childhood photos, family pictures, travel souvenirs, and proposal photos. Guests enjoy learning more about your journey together.


22. Incorporate Seasonal Decorations

Take advantage of the season — pumpkins in autumn, fresh greenery in winter, wildflowers in spring, and citrus accents in summer. Seasonal items are often more affordable and readily available.


23. Use Decorative Trays

Group candles, flowers, and small decorations on trays for a polished appearance. This simple styling trick creates intentional, cohesive displays.


24. Keep the Entrance Simple but Elegant

First impressions matter. Decorate your entrance with a welcome sign, balloon arrangement, lanterns, greenery, and soft lighting. Guests will immediately feel excited to celebrate.
